GithubHelp home page GithubHelp logo

Comments (12)

mika76 avatar mika76 commented on September 27, 2024 2

Watch out @nullpainter, that's how they get us! 😉

I'll merge, sort out the releases and the screenshots some time today. Also time to update the website...

from mamesaver.

mika76 avatar mika76 commented on September 27, 2024 1

No stress - I'll be sleeping from now till then 🤣

from mamesaver.

mika76 avatar mika76 commented on September 27, 2024

I will try debug this when I'm at my VS2017 machine...

from mamesaver.

mika76 avatar mika76 commented on September 27, 2024

I can confirm if I change the turn off display setting to 1 Min, then Mamesaver works. Putting back to Never crashes again.

from mamesaver.

nullpainter avatar nullpainter commented on September 27, 2024

Oops, I also fixed this by making the TimeSpan nullable. Will create PR for you to look over. Having it nullable and only conditionally create the timer is a bit less hacky than using min/max value.

from mamesaver.

nullpainter avatar nullpainter commented on September 27, 2024

Actually, it'll end up with a merge conflict if I just create a PR. Here's my version of the fix:
nullpainter@c9c42a4

There's logging and no timer creation if there's no sleep configured.

from mamesaver.

nullpainter avatar nullpainter commented on September 27, 2024

Unrelated, but I also added some fixes suggested by VS code analysis in nullpainter@ca5deae

from mamesaver.

mika76 avatar mika76 commented on September 27, 2024

Hey @nullpainter I'm happy to accept your fixes - is there some way I can add these manually? Can't you just merge master into your branch and overwrite my changes?

from mamesaver.

nullpainter avatar nullpainter commented on September 27, 2024

Yep, I can do that. Probably be this evening though (so, in around six hours).

from mamesaver.

nullpainter avatar nullpainter commented on September 27, 2024

All done. Sorry about that - I fixed it before I saw that you already had 😁

btw, do you only have two games currently or are you worried about implied copyright issues? Also - and hardly an issue (just me being a little OCD) - but the MAME icon looks a bit gross against your brown. Wondering whether the bog-standard Windows 10 colour scheme may look better for sample screenshots?

from mamesaver.

mika76 avatar mika76 commented on September 27, 2024

All done. Sorry about that - I fixed it before I saw that you already had 😁

No prob at all - you were a little quiet so I thought you were busy and I would help you out a bit 😊

btw, do you only have two games currently or are you worried about implied copyright issues? Also - and hardly an issue (just me being a little OCD) - but the MAME icon looks a bit gross against your brown. Wondering whether the bog-standard Windows 10 colour scheme may look better for sample screenshots?

Hah it's my theme on my parallels VM - looks much better with the brownish background I guess. Yeah it's not the best. I wanted to include all the settings as screenshots and some demo ones too. I'll update when I get back to my other laptop - just been a bit busy to sit with it.

I only had 2 roms because I don't really use mame on my mac.

from mamesaver.

nullpainter avatar nullpainter commented on September 27, 2024

No prob at all - you were a little quiet so I thought you were busy and I would help you out a bit 😊

Thanks; appreciated! Defects are shameful so I felt a moral responsibility to fix 😉

from mamesaver.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.